O'Hara cues up for Championship

BUDDING pool player Ciaran O'Hara racked up an impressive quarter-final place at the recent All-Ireland Intervarsities Snooker and Pool Competition, held in Dundalk.

The 21-year-old was representing North West Regional College, where he is currently undertaking the Higher National Diploma in Architectural Technology.

The Greysteel student took on 230 of the keenest shots in Ireland over a weekend on the baize tables, and was delighted to make it so far through the tight competition, on his third visit to the All-Ireland event.

The annual competition attracts students from Colleges and Universities across Northern Ireland and the Republic of Ireland, and is one of the highlights in Pool’s competitive calendar.

O’Hara thoroughly enjoyed his previous experiences at the competition, and finds the All-Ireland challenge allows him to continue to improve his skills on the baize tables. North West Regional College’s Willie O’Donnell congratulated Ciaran on his achievement.

“We are thrilled that Ciaran performed so well at the All-Ireland competition – a quarter final place among 230 competitors is a fantastic result, and we’re very proud to have Ciaran representing the College in this sport.”
